macrophagic myofascitis
Definition: an inflammatory myopathy detected in patients with diffuse arthromyalgias and severe fatigue; characterized by muscle infiltration by granular periodic acid-Schiff reagent–positive macrophages and lymphocytes. The inclusions detected in the macrophages have been identified as aluminum hydroxide, an immunostimulatory compound used as a vaccine adjuvant.
